The Gentle Fist Art Clenching Snake Jaw (柔拳法掴蛇顎, Jūkenpō Kaku Hebiago) is a technique that employs classical grappling elements from martial arts to the Gentle Fist principle. Rather than actively strike the opponent and disable their tenketsu, this technique is meant to inflict great pain in a single motion. Within combat, should one find the opportunity, they clasp the opponent with their own palm and maintain their hold. The impact of the stream of chakra sent through the grappling motion as well as continuous pain received from the tightening of the hold often times can cause the victim to surrender under the pain. Alternatively, it can be used for a short period of time to give an opening for other Taijutsu maneuvers.
